Overview

The Sr Manager – Strategic Sourcing is responsible for developing and executing the Sourcing Strategies in the Fiber Glass Roving, Resins, Plastics & Thermoforming categories in alignment with e business strategic objectives.

 

This position will manage commercial relationships with key strategic suppliers in assigned core commodity areas across the organization. Independently and in collaboration with key internal stakeholders, this position with employ category, contract, and other supply management strategies to manage mutual expectations and relationships, control risk and minimize costs to the extent feasible. This individual provides leadership to the category team in the development and execution of supply base management strategies that support the Operational, Commercial, and Technical requirements of the organization.

The Sr Manager – Strategic Sourcing will be responsible for managing a group of individuals by providing coaching, feedback, and promoting opportunities to maintain and grow organizational talent while it will be responsible for the collective attainment of business goals.

Responsibilities

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Develop and execute strategic sourcing and other supply management strategies that drive continuous improvements in supplier performance, reduce costs, minimize risk and harvest innovation across the supply base.
  • Develop, negotiate and manage LTA’s with key suppliers to manage supply and total cost of ownership (TCO).
  • Consistently transform & optimize the supply base through deployment of strategic sourcing tools & processes.
  • Lead cross-functional category team(s) and supplier team meetings in the execution of sourcing initiatives, cost reduction & productivity projects.
  • Coach and mentor team members to build the organization’s category expertise.
  • Build and maintain successful and effective business relationships with internal and external stakeholders.
  • Develop and present cost models to understand cost drivers of purchased components and/or services and utilize negotiation and cost management tools to obtain best in class pricing on all components and/or services.
  • Monitor market trends and maintain high level of subject matter expertise in defined areas of responsibility.
  • Establish and communicate supplier performance expectations, monitor and drive compliance with suppliers.
  • Ensure continuity of supply by proactively managing critical supply issues, secure and maintain effective supplier capacity to meet current and future needs.
  • Provide subject matter expertise and guidance to the Risk Management Team in support of hedging, inflation forecasting, costing, and pricing activities
  • Visit supplier manufacturing facilities to conduct audits, verify capabilities, and build relationships
  • Introduce new suppliers, products, processes, and technologies to Design and Engineering to give our brands a competitive advantage
  • Identify and develop ideas for cost reduction through consolidation of suppliers and requirements, alternative sourcing, labor reduction, warranty reduction, working capital reduction, and value analysis / value engineering
